What we measure — and what we refuse to
This site rates crypto services through one lens: Open-data scorecard. The question behind every score is “What do public, checkable sources say about how much this is trusted, how proven it is, and whether it stays up?” Not how many features it has, not how big it is. The failure mode we care about is the one that costs you money: Looks polished, but thin on the things you can actually verify — little value locked, unaudited, brand-new, or invisible when it breaks.

The criteria we publish
Weights sum to 100%. When a criterion is n/a for a given service, its weight is redistributed proportionally across the ones we could measure — so a score is always out of what we actually looked at, and the card tells you how much of the total that was.
Scale of value trusted
Total value locked (DeFi), on-chain reserves (exchanges) or circulating market cap (stablecoins), from DefiLlama. Capital is the market voting with its money: a protocol holding billions has been trusted and stress-tested in a way a $2M one has not. Scored on a log scale — the gap from $10M to $100M means more than $10B to $20B. n/a where the service holds no measurable on-chain value (most wallets, tools, cards).
Security audits
Number of published security audits with links, from DefiLlama's audit field. Not a guarantee — audited protocols still get exploited — but an unaudited contract holding funds is a red flag, and audit links let you read the findings yourself. n/a for services with no smart-contract surface to audit.
Track record
Time the service has been live and continuously operating, from DefiLlama's listing date or the documented launch. Survival is signal: most failures happen young, so a protocol that has run through a full market cycle has cleared a bar a three-month-old one has not.
Multi-chain reach
Number of chains the service is deployed on, from DefiLlama. Breadth is resilience and adoption — but only a minor factor, since a focused single-chain protocol can be excellent. Never the main event, only a tie-breaker.
Latency
Median time to first byte from a public endpoint, our own probe, slowest sample discarded, single location. Scored within a category against peers timed the same way, never across categories.
Status transparency
Whether a public, machine-readable status page exists (statuspage / incident.io / instatus). A service you can audit from outside beats one you cannot — even if the opaque one happens to be reliable.
Incident repair time
Median minutes from published report to published resolution across the incidents a service logged, from its own status feed. n/a where no incident feed is published.
Peg stability
Absolute deviation of the live price from the intended peg, from DefiLlama's stablecoins feed. Stablecoins only: a coin trading at 0.94 is failing at its one job. n/a for everything else.
The weights move by category
One set of weights across eighteen categories would be a single method wearing eighteen hats. A DEX lives or dies on liquidity, so value locked leads there. A bridge is the biggest exploit target in crypto, so audits edge out even the value it carries. A hardware wallet has no on-chain value at all — age is the trust signal. A stablecoin is judged first on market cap and then on whether it actually holds its peg. Arrows show the move against the site default.

What we don’t publish
We only score what a public source can back. Two things a rankings page usually leads with, we leave out — because we cannot get them honestly from open data. We would rather show you the hole than fill it with something plausible.
Fees and real cost
Not published: honest all-in cost (fees + spread + slippage) needs a live seat and repeated real trades on every venue. We have not done that, so we do not score it rather than copy a headline fee that hides the spread.
UX and support
Not published: product feel and support quality are subjective and cannot be read from open data without opening accounts everywhere. Left out rather than faked.
Where this method is weak
- TVL rewards size, not safety. Value locked is the market voting with its money, and it is the best open proxy we have for adoption — but big protocols get exploited too, and a new one can be excellent. We score it on a log scale so it dominates less than raw dollars would, and never let it stand alone.
- An audit is not a clean bill of health. We count published audits with links, not their quality. Audited protocols still get drained. The score rewards having been looked at and letting you read the findings — not a guarantee the code is safe.
- Age is a floor, not the truth. For on-chain protocols we use the DefiLlama listing date, which can be later than the real launch, so it understates age for some old names. For off-chain services we use documented founding years. Either way it is a lower bound.
- Latency is measured from one place. One location, a handful of samples, slowest discarded. Real, and our own, but not global — a service can be quick for us and slow for you. Scored only within a category, against peers timed the same way; where the surface differs it drops to context.
- A missing status page is scored, not excused. If a service publishes no status feed we score STATUS low. That is a judgment: a service you cannot audit from outside is worse than one you can, even if it happens to be reliable. A page we simply failed to find would read as “publishes nothing”, so a blocked or unreadable one scores n/a instead of a mark against them.
- Redistributing n/a rewards opacity, so we cap it. Spreading an unmeasured criterion’s weight across the rest is the fair rule, but it has a sharp edge: points are docked on the criteria that need the most data, so the less we know about a service the less there is to hold against it. Left alone that floats the least-measured service to the top. A place in a ranking therefore needs at least a quarter of the category’s weight measured; below that a service is listed, with its numbers, outside the order.
- A missing status page may be our blind spot. We read three status platforms. A service on a fourth, or one whose bot filter turns our probe away, is not marked down for it — that case scores n/a and says so. But a page we simply failed to find at the conventional host would read here as “publishes nothing”, and that would be our error wearing their name.
- Coverage is thin and every card admits it. The heaviest criterion is n/a everywhere, so no verdict here rests on more than about two thirds of its category’s weight, and many rest on a third. The percentage next to each score is the honest size of the claim.

Absolute disqualifiers
A service is excluded from every rating, whatever else it scores:
- user funds never returned after an incident;
- a confirmed pattern of obstructing withdrawals (not a single complaint);
- a custodial service with neither proof-of-reserves nor a licence;
- volume falsification, by independent metrics;
- an anonymous team running a custodial model.
Exclusions are published on the category page — who, and why. Any service owned by or affiliated with this site’s owner does not appear in the ratings at all: not scored, not listed, not compared.
